Output 80593531c704f9fdcef72f9d654b9fe0938efab0ea32be193f688b2a8a5a9f66:2

value
709915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15c4f7488b05e4cf59a2281c0a0684f0a8f9a3b OP_EQUAL
address
3PhDMcSuvhxVgU4Rmz2NRBoZKwMm23Avnt
transaction
80593531c704f9fdcef72f9d654b9fe0938efab0ea32be193f688b2a8a5a9f66
spent
true